Output 168d709a3578bb386ade23cbb3020b2a6ed6bdf7ff60f0958b3e988df0b8b35b:0

value
75889186
script pubkey
OP_0 OP_PUSHBYTES_20 d9ebf421d7d32ca6f13a1885af11e887cb8b09f5
address
bc1qm84lggwh6vk2duf6rzz67y0gsl9ckz047e4tu5
transaction
168d709a3578bb386ade23cbb3020b2a6ed6bdf7ff60f0958b3e988df0b8b35b
spent
true